WWE is doing something very different for Money In The Bank this year. They need to figure something out due to the COVID-19 pandemic. Now they will present cinematic MITB matches from the WWE Headquarters in Stamford.

Click here to check out the first photos of the rooftop construction for Money In The Bank.

Former WWE referee Jimmy Korderas is well aware of WWE’s plans. He also doesn’t quite know for sure what kind of match fans will get on May 10th. He released another Reffin’ Rant video addressing WWE’s next pay-per-view event.

Two schools of thought here. This could be creative and interesting, but this could also be a train wreck. I could be wrong about the train wreck thing. Yes, they’ve been creative and thinking outside the box. I think this box… maybe they should have stayed inside the box for this one? We’ll wait and see, I’m hoping for the best.
